Yacolt, WA Facts, Population, Income, Demographics, Economy

Median Age: 27.2 years

Median Rent: Median gross rent in 2017: $1,130.

Cost of Living: March 2019 cost of living index in Yacolt: 92.1 (less than average, U.S. average is 100)

Poverty (overall): Percentage of residents living in poverty in 2017: 11.2%

Ancestries: Ancestries: Finnish (14.7%), American (13.7%), German (11.2%), Norwegian (6.8%), European (5.2%), English (3.7%).

Zip Codes: 98675

Median Incomes:
      Estimated median household income in 2017: $65,256 (it was $39,444 in 2000)
      Estimated per capita income in 2017: $21,394 (it was $12,529 in 2000)
      Estimated median house or condo value in 2017: $216,566 (it was $109,600 in 2000) Yacolt:$216,566WA:$339,000

Races:
      White alone - 1,479 - 94.4%
      Hispanic - 33 - 2.1%
      Two or more races - 29 - 1.9%
      American Indian alone - 10 - 0.6%
      Black alone - 8 - 0.5%
      Asian alone - 6 - 0.4%
      Other race alone - 1 - 0.06%

Alcohol tests are administered for a variety of different reasons and greatly differ from drug tests. Drug tests (those that analyze samples of hair and urine) attempt to detect usage of illegal drugs over a lengthy time period, generally ranging from a week to several months. However, alcohol tests are aimed at detecting consumption of a legal - though regulated - substance within a much shorter timeframe. Rather than testing for past usage, an alcohol drug test will register only the immediate presence of alcohol in the human body.

Breath Alcohol Drug Test

Otherwise known as a breathalyzer, Breath Alcohol Test (BATs) make frequent appearances in sitcoms and crime shows. That is because they are quite commonly used given that the test is easy to administer and provides nearly instantaneous results. Police officers rely on breathalyzer exams to detect when drivers are on the road and above the legal alcohol limit. Because BATs provide only a current-moment snapshot of the body's blood alcohol content, they should only be administered when someone is required to be sober at the current time. Such cases would include driving a vehicle or operating heavy machinery.

DOT only permits a breath alcohol test. Urine alcohol tests are not permitted by the Department of Transportation. Therefore, a DOT regulated employee would take a 5 panel DOT urine test but only a breath alcohol test if required.

Urine Alcohol Drug Test Finally, for rare cases an EtG exam will be administered to determine if alcohol has been consumed over a 5 day period. EtGs are typically reserved for individuals undergoing a court-ordered sobriety or alcohol rehabilitation program.

Local Area Info: Yacolt, Washington

Yacolt is a Klickitat term meaning "haunted place" or "place of (evil)spirits" another name it was known by was "the valley of lost children". In September 1902 the town, which consisted of only 15 buildings at the time, was nearly destroyed by the Yacolt Burn, the largest fire in state history. Yacolt was rebuilt over time and officially incorporated on July 31, 1908.

As of the census of 2010, there were 1,566 people, 454 households, and 384 families residing in the town. The population density was 3,132.0 inhabitants per square mile (1,209.3/km2). There were 484 housing units at an average density of 968.0 per square mile (373.7/km2). The racial makeup of the town was 95.8% White, 0.5% African American, 1.1% Native American, 0.4% Asian, 0.2% from other races, and 2.0%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 2.1% of the population.

There were 454 households of which 55.3%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 68.3% were married couples living together, 8.4% had a female householder with no husband present, 7.9% had a male householder with no wife present, and 15.4% were non-families. 10.8% of all households were made up of individuals and 3.7%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older. The average household size was 3.45 and the average family size was 3.68.
